Seite 1 von 1

REST API CSV Import

Verfasst: 13. Mär 2019 16:34
von tuningshop
Servus,
für einige sind es wahlweise aneinander gereihte Großbuchstaben, welche keinen Sinn machen. Für andere täglich Brot.

Ich suche ein entweder fertiges Produkt was eine , auf dem Server liegende, CSV über eine REST API Schnittstelle importieren kann oder jemand der sowas baut :)

Bisher lass ich das "hart" über einen Cronjob in die Shopware Datenbank importieren. Das geht leider bei Dreamrobot nicht. Alle nötigen Daten kann ich zur Verfügung stellen.

Vielleicht kennt jemand so ein Tool und jemand, der es mal eingerichtet hat

Re: REST API CSV Import

Verfasst: 13. Mär 2019 16:48
von Compusoft
Hey Du, für alle SHOPWARE Shops haben wir einen Windows Software die automatisiert tabellenartige Daten (CAV, XLS, MDB, XLSX, TXT, DBF etc.) von einem SERVER lädt (i.d.R. die vom Lieferanten) und dann in SHOPWARE synchronisiert. Nicht nur reiner Import was ja ein Zuwachs wäre sondern auch Artikel aus dem Shop löscht (weil nicht mehr produziert vom Lieferanten) oder deaktiviert.
Egal wieviel Lieferanten, egal wieviel Artikel. voll automatisch. Name des Produktes: shoplukasflex.
evtl. hilft dir das ja. Ach so: Shopware Version spielt dabei keine Rolle. und nein wir gehen NICHT über die API, daher können wir Felder einlesen die sonst nicht gehen würden.

Re: REST API CSV Import

Verfasst: 13. Mär 2019 17:03
von tuningshop
Soll aber ja nicht in Shopware, das haben wir schon - Sondern in Dreamrobot per REST API.

Re: REST API CSV Import

Verfasst: 13. Mär 2019 20:32
von Xantiva
Vielleicht solltest Du noch etwas konkreter werden ...

Was für Daten sind in Deiner CSV? Die "REST API" bietet ja diverse Funktionen an: z. B. Aufträge anlegen, Artikel bearbeiten, usw.

Re: REST API CSV Import

Verfasst: 13. Mär 2019 20:39
von tuningshop
Nur Lagerbestand

Re: REST API CSV Import

Verfasst: 13. Mär 2019 20:54
von Xantiva
Ok, da gibt es sogar ein Beispiel in der Doku dazu. Hast Du in der CSV auch die "StockId" von DR?

Re: REST API CSV Import

Verfasst: 13. Mär 2019 21:10
von tuningshop
Wenn Du diese interne Lagernummer meinst. Nein - der Abgleich muss über die Artikelnummer laufen. Wir haben zusätzlich zum eigenen Lagerbestand noch 3 Lieferanten für sperrige Artikel welch direkt versendet werden. Daher aktuell 3 CSV mit stetig aktuellen Beständen.

Re: REST API CSV Import

Verfasst: 13. Mär 2019 22:51
von Xantiva
Dann wird man für jeden Artikel zuerst die Stock ID ermitteln müssen. An wie viele Artikel denkst Du? 100, 1.000, 10.000, ...?
Egal, wenn Du keinen findest der schon was passendes hat, meld' Dich noch mal bei mir.

Ciao,
Mike